Budding Jamies, Ginos and Nigellas can get stuck into cooking at Dean Clough this February half term with The Cooking School's Chefs' Club. Regular Chefs' Club member Claudia Bartholomew has not missed a class yet; in fact she even attended 2 in one week when she was crossing over from the 8-12 years group into the 13-16 years group! Claudia now has her own twitter account (@claudiateencookwith the help of her mum) and has whipped up all sorts from ginger sponge to chicken stir fry and even a giant princess cake.
